OUR STORY...LEARN MORE ABOUT THE COMPANY'S HISTORY:
Cincinnati School of Music is a family-owned company, established in 2012 by a husband and wife team with a passion for music and community. With a background in music performance, music education, and business they wanted to create an educational space where local musicians could share their talents and passions by teaching students of all ages. Since its establishment, CSM has expanded to include five convenient locations in Mason, Montgomery, Maineville, Middletown, and Anderson.
Named one of Ohio's 50 Best Workplaces for four years, voted "Best Music Instruction" in Cincy Magazine for nine years, and recognized as "The Face of Music Instruction" in Cincinnati Magazine, and CSM is proud to provide excellent music education to the Cincinnati community!
WHAT TO EXPECT:
The basic starting responsibilities include:
- Assisting parents and students by phone, text, email, and in-person
- Using computer software to schedule music lessons and process tuition payments
- Using Gmail to send emails to students, parents, and teachers
- Using a business messenger software to send text messages to students, parents, and teachers
- Processing new student enrollments/basic data entry through a scheduling software
- Assisting with and prioritizing miscellaneous projects and tasks as assigned
- Using Google Drive to create fliers
- Office cleaning
- Working independently in an office setting
